git://git.onelab.eu
/
linux-2.6.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
fedora core 6 1.2949 + vserver 2.2.0
[linux-2.6.git]
/
drivers
/
md
/
dm-round-robin.c
diff --git
a/drivers/md/dm-round-robin.c
b/drivers/md/dm-round-robin.c
index
c5a16c5
..
a348a97
100644
(file)
--- a/
drivers/md/dm-round-robin.c
+++ b/
drivers/md/dm-round-robin.c
@@
-21,7
+21,7
@@
*---------------------------------------------------------------*/
struct path_info {
struct list_head list;
*---------------------------------------------------------------*/
struct path_info {
struct list_head list;
- struct path *path;
+ struct
dm_
path *path;
unsigned repeat_count;
};
unsigned repeat_count;
};
@@
-80,7
+80,7
@@
static void rr_destroy(struct path_selector *ps)
ps->context = NULL;
}
ps->context = NULL;
}
-static int rr_status(struct path_selector *ps, struct path *path,
+static int rr_status(struct path_selector *ps, struct
dm_
path *path,
status_type_t type, char *result, unsigned int maxlen)
{
struct path_info *pi;
status_type_t type, char *result, unsigned int maxlen)
{
struct path_info *pi;
@@
-106,7
+106,7
@@
static int rr_status(struct path_selector *ps, struct path *path,
* Called during initialisation to register each path with an
* optional repeat_count.
*/
* Called during initialisation to register each path with an
* optional repeat_count.
*/
-static int rr_add_path(struct path_selector *ps, struct path *path,
+static int rr_add_path(struct path_selector *ps, struct
dm_
path *path,
int argc, char **argv, char **error)
{
struct selector *s = (struct selector *) ps->context;
int argc, char **argv, char **error)
{
struct selector *s = (struct selector *) ps->context;
@@
-136,12
+136,12
@@
static int rr_add_path(struct path_selector *ps, struct path *path,
path->pscontext = pi;
path->pscontext = pi;
- list_add(&pi->list, &s->valid_paths);
+ list_add
_tail
(&pi->list, &s->valid_paths);
return 0;
}
return 0;
}
-static void rr_fail_path(struct path_selector *ps, struct path *p)
+static void rr_fail_path(struct path_selector *ps, struct
dm_
path *p)
{
struct selector *s = (struct selector *) ps->context;
struct path_info *pi = p->pscontext;
{
struct selector *s = (struct selector *) ps->context;
struct path_info *pi = p->pscontext;
@@
-149,7
+149,7
@@
static void rr_fail_path(struct path_selector *ps, struct path *p)
list_move(&pi->list, &s->invalid_paths);
}
list_move(&pi->list, &s->invalid_paths);
}
-static int rr_reinstate_path(struct path_selector *ps, struct path *p)
+static int rr_reinstate_path(struct path_selector *ps, struct
dm_
path *p)
{
struct selector *s = (struct selector *) ps->context;
struct path_info *pi = p->pscontext;
{
struct selector *s = (struct selector *) ps->context;
struct path_info *pi = p->pscontext;
@@
-159,7
+159,7
@@
static int rr_reinstate_path(struct path_selector *ps, struct path *p)
return 0;
}
return 0;
}
-static struct path *rr_select_path(struct path_selector *ps,
+static struct
dm_
path *rr_select_path(struct path_selector *ps,
unsigned *repeat_count)
{
struct selector *s = (struct selector *) ps->context;
unsigned *repeat_count)
{
struct selector *s = (struct selector *) ps->context;